Transaction 84c3889ec80a93171e92c33ebc520083d04e45053cb348ce8998ded0ccac3dab
1 Input
1 Output
-
84c3889ec80a93171e92c33ebc520083d04e45053cb348ce8998ded0ccac3dab:0
- value
- 99987796
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f3742527ad1dfb0fabebb0a35a202f8a4030e7 OP_EQUAL
- address
- 3BMEX9N5CPSeDwtsvLqgR4B2keK5xAJAm8